Output 7b13a3ad160bbd8d29ca3765e0536a1a6316031a3eca5936e017d62793ca16fe:0

value
522493
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f0b774a4fea72be4104bcd6d317842566cacfc0 OP_EQUAL
address
3BpAfWMtKpwpqbXEkmMEA2ybXpdkGUxuU4
transaction
7b13a3ad160bbd8d29ca3765e0536a1a6316031a3eca5936e017d62793ca16fe
confirmations
4253
spent
true